Jimmy Whispers is a DIY eccentro pop crooner from Chicago. He's talented. He's funny. He stage dives. He's a future star, probably. And (here's the big news) he's good!

Think slacker soul and you might be on the right track.

Mr. Whispers' debut album “Summer in Pain" (see: organ pop jams) was recorded with his iPhone's memo app (never used it!) and it's catchy and messy and really good. Besides seeing him play (and you totally should) it's a great way of getting into Jimmy's goodness. (Please note: it's a grower. Give it space. Give it time. Breathe with it.)
